THE CHAMPIONS’ CATAMARANS

For nearly a quarter of a century, the Trophée Clairefontaine has had thousands of spectators dreaming, by presenting short, very spectacular regattas in nautical stadiums, as close to the boats as possible

Aboard these 7.65-metre, one-design catamarans, designed by VPLP, 72 sailing champions have followed one another in 24 editions... For the record, Loïck Peyron, with 7 victories, remains the Champion of Champions, ahead of Michel Desjoyeaux (4 victories) and Franck Cammas and his 3 victories!

Recently put up for sale, the Trophée Clairefontaine catamaran fleet has found a buyer, and is now going to be used for match race training, as well as the organization of corporate regattas for companies, discovery cruises in the Golfe du Morbihan, France, or raids in the Iles du Ponant.

Because the fleet of COD 25s (Catamaran One Design) is now based at Lorient, but can easily travel in a container... And why not dream of a new Trophée des Champions de Voile in Lorient, from 2015?
